Hungary - Export of Building Blocks and Bricks of Cement, Concrete or Artificial Stone

Since 2014, Hungary Export of Building Blocks and Bricks of Cement, Concrete or Artificial Stone grew 5.2% year on year. With €12,121,748.09 in 2019, the country was number 9 comparing other countries in Export of Building Blocks and Bricks of Cement, Concrete or Artificial Stone. Hungary is overtaken by Spain, which was number 8 at €12,398,210.49 and is followed by Ireland at €11,681,169.56. Germany ranked the highest with €115,593,515.45 in 2019, that is a decrease of 0.3% versus 2018. Netherlands, Belgium and Italy resp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Netherlands witnessed the best average annual growth at +21.8% per year, while Finland was the worst growing country at -23.7% per year.
